在macOS上实现完美歌词同步:LyricsX完整配置指南
2026/6/3 19:36:34 网站建设 项目流程

在macOS上实现完美歌词同步:LyricsX完整配置指南

【免费下载链接】LyricsX🎶 Ultimate lyrics app for macOS.项目地址: https://gitcode.com/gh_mirrors/ly/LyricsX

你是否曾经在听歌时,因为找不到合适的歌词而烦恼?或者歌词显示总是跟不上音乐节奏?这些问题在macOS上尤其常见,而LyricsX正是解决这些痛点的最佳macOS歌词工具。这款开源应用不仅能自动搜索并显示实时歌词同步,还能提供桌面歌词显示,让你的音乐体验更加完整。无论是工作时的背景音乐,还是学习外语时的跟唱练习,LyricsX都能为你带来无缝的歌词体验。

重新定义你的macOS音乐体验 🎵

想象一下,当你打开音乐播放器,歌词就像魔法一样自动出现在桌面上,完美同步每一个节拍。这就是LyricsX带给你的体验——一个智能的歌词助手,默默工作在你的macOS系统中。

看看这张截图,你会发现LyricsX的桌面歌词显示多么优雅。它悬浮在桌面上,跟随音乐节奏逐句高亮,就像有个私人卡拉OK教练在身边。更重要的是,它支持所有主流音乐播放器,无论是iTunes、Spotify还是Vox,都能完美配合。

传统播放器的歌词困境 vs LyricsX的解决方案

还记得那些需要手动搜索歌词的日子吗?或者歌词总是错位几秒钟的尴尬?LyricsX彻底改变了这一切:

  • 自动搜索:播放歌曲时自动从多个来源获取歌词
  • 精准同步:毫秒级的歌词时间轴匹配
  • 多播放器支持:无缝切换不同音乐应用
  • 个性化显示:自由定制字体、颜色和位置

三步完成基本配置 🚀

第一步:安装LyricsX

打开终端,输入这行简单的命令:

brew install --cask lyricsx

或者你也可以从Mac App Store直接下载。安装完成后,LyricsX会出现在你的应用程序文件夹中。

第二步:选择你的音乐播放器

首次启动LyricsX时,它会自动检测你系统中安装的音乐播放器。在偏好设置中,你可以看到所有支持的播放器列表:

  • iTunes/Apple Music
  • Spotify
  • Vox
  • Audirvana
  • Swinsian

选择"Auto"选项,LyricsX会自动识别当前正在播放音乐的应用程序,实现真正的智能切换。

第三步:启动你的第一首歌

现在,打开你最喜欢的音乐播放器,播放一首歌。LyricsX会自动开始工作——搜索歌词、同步时间轴,然后在桌面上显示完美的歌词。

如果自动搜索没有找到合适的歌词,别担心!点击菜单栏中的LyricsX图标,选择"Search Lyrics",手动输入歌曲信息,LyricsX会从多个歌词源为你寻找最佳匹配。

个性化你的歌词显示界面 🎨

LyricsX最棒的地方在于它的高度可定制性。你可以根据自己的喜好调整每一个细节:

桌面歌词模式

这是我最喜欢的模式!歌词悬浮在桌面上,你可以:

  • 自由拖动到任意位置
  • 调整透明度,让它完美融入桌面背景
  • 自定义字体、颜色和大小
  • 设置歌词滚动速度

菜单栏模式

如果你喜欢简洁的界面,菜单栏模式是绝佳选择。歌词会紧凑地显示在菜单栏中,不占用桌面空间,但依然提供完整的歌词信息。

卡拉OK模式

想要跟着唱?开启卡拉OK模式!歌词会逐字高亮,精确到毫秒的时间同步让你永远不会错过任何一个音节。这个功能特别适合学习外语歌曲。

高级显示设置

在LyricsX/Controller/Preferences/目录下的设置文件中,你可以找到更多高级选项:

  • 歌词字体和颜色定制
  • 显示位置和大小调整
  • 透明度控制
  • 动画效果设置

提升歌词匹配准确率的技巧 🔍

确保歌曲信息完整

歌词匹配的准确性很大程度上取决于歌曲的元数据。确保你的音乐文件包含:

  • 正确的歌曲名称
  • 准确的艺术家信息
  • 完整的专辑信息

使用标准命名格式

如果你的音乐文件来自不同来源,建议统一命名格式为"歌手 - 歌名",这样LyricsX能更容易识别。

多源搜索策略

LyricsX支持从多个歌词源搜索,包括TTPod、QQMusic、163等。如果某个来源没有找到,它会自动尝试下一个,大大提高了成功率。

手动校准时间轴

有时候自动同步可能不太完美,这时你可以:

  1. 点击菜单栏中的LyricsX图标
  2. 使用"+"和"-"按钮微调歌词偏移
  3. 双击歌词行跳转到对应时间点进行精确校准

常见问题快速解决 🛠️

问题1:LyricsX无法检测到播放器

解决方法:

  • 确保音乐播放器正在运行
  • 检查LyricsX偏好设置中是否选择了正确的播放器
  • 重启LyricsX和音乐播放器

问题2:歌词显示不同步

解决方法:

  • 使用菜单栏中的偏移调整按钮
  • 重新搜索歌词
  • 检查网络连接是否正常

问题3:找不到特定歌曲的歌词

解决方法:

  • 尝试手动搜索
  • 检查歌曲信息是否正确
  • 确认歌曲名称和艺术家拼写无误

问题4:歌词显示异常

解决方法:

  • 检查歌词文件编码
  • 尝试重新下载歌词
  • 查看LyricsX/Component/目录下的日志文件

挖掘LyricsX的隐藏功能 💎

快捷键配置

LyricsX支持完全自定义快捷键,让你在不离开当前应用的情况下快速控制歌词显示。默认的快捷键包括:

  • ⌘+L:显示/隐藏桌面歌词
  • ⌘+⇧+L:切换歌词显示模式
  • ⌘+↑/↓:调整歌词偏移量

你可以在偏好设置的"Shortcut"标签页中自定义这些快捷键。

歌词文件管理

所有下载的歌词文件都保存在~/Library/Application Support/LyricsX/Lyrics/目录中。你可以:

  • 备份歌词文件到其他位置
  • 手动添加自定义歌词文件(支持LRC和LRCX格式)
  • 删除不需要的歌词文件

双语歌词支持

LyricsX支持自动在简体和繁体中文之间转换。在"General"设置中,你可以选择:

  • 自动转换:根据系统语言自动选择
  • 简体中文优先
  • 繁体中文优先
  • 不转换:保持原始歌词格式

LRCX格式的优势

LyricsX使用自定义的LRCX歌词格式,相比传统的LRC格式,LRCX支持:

  • 逐字时间标签:精确到每个单词的显示时间
  • 多语言翻译:支持同一歌曲的多种语言歌词
  • 丰富元数据:包含更多歌曲相关信息
  • 向后兼容:完全兼容标准LRC格式

参与开源社区贡献 👥

LyricsX是一个完全开源的项目,这意味着你可以:

  • 查看完整的源代码在LyricsX/目录下
  • 提交Bug报告或功能请求
  • 改进现有功能代码
  • 添加新的歌词源支持
  • 翻译应用界面到更多语言

项目结构概览

如果你对开发感兴趣,可以探索项目的核心结构:

LyricsX/ ├── Component/ # 核心组件 │ ├── AppController.swift │ ├── AppDelegate.swift │ └── SelectedPlayer.swift ├── Controller/ # 视图控制器 │ ├── Preferences/ # 偏好设置 │ ├── LyricsHUDViewController.swift │ └── SearchLyricsViewController.swift ├── View/ # 视图组件 │ ├── KaraokeLyricsView.swift │ └── ScrollLyricsView.swift └── Utility/ # 工具类

如何开始贡献

  1. 克隆项目仓库:git clone https://gitcode.com/gh_mirrors/ly/LyricsX
  2. 阅读README.md了解项目结构
  3. 查看Issues列表找到可以贡献的地方
  4. 提交Pull Request分享你的改进

让音乐体验更完美的最后建议 🌟

给新用户的建议

  1. 从简单开始:先使用默认设置,熟悉基本功能后再进行个性化调整
  2. 尝试不同模式:桌面歌词、菜单栏、卡拉OK模式各有特色
  3. 保持更新:定期检查更新,获取最新功能

给高级用户的建议

  1. 探索自定义设置:深度定制你的歌词显示体验
  2. 学习LRCX格式:利用高级功能提升歌词质量
  3. 参与社区:分享你的使用经验和改进建议

最佳实践习惯

  • 保持LyricsX和音乐播放器同时运行
  • 定期清理不需要的歌词文件
  • 为常用歌曲手动校准歌词时间
  • 利用快捷键提高操作效率

LyricsX不仅仅是一个歌词工具,它是你音乐体验的延伸。无论你是日常听歌放松,还是专业音乐学习,LyricsX都能为你提供完美的歌词同步体验。现在就开始使用,让每一首歌都拥有完美的歌词陪伴吧!🎶

【免费下载链接】LyricsX🎶 Ultimate lyrics app for macOS.项目地址: https://gitcode.com/gh_mirrors/ly/LyricsX

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询